Following the news of the Imo State Police investigating officers allegedly involved in cult activities, another controversial comment read, “If you no belong you no go fit do uniform work.”
This statement implies that being part of a cult or secret group is a requirement to thrive in Nigeria’s uniformed services, including the police. Such a mindset is deeply troubling, as it normalizes corruption and links public service to criminal alliances rather than integrity or competence. Comments like this discourage honest individuals from joining the force, promote a toxic belief that wrongdoing is necessary for survival, and further erode public trust in law enforcement institutions.
